It's necessary to bill a fair cost that shows the high quality of your goods and the initiative associated with making themTo cost a cake recipe, very first identify the cost of all ingredients used in the recipe. Next, approximate the expense of utilities, equipment devaluation, and your time. Include these together to obtain the total price, after that include a revenue margin to figure out the selling price. A bakery that focuses on catering would certainly prepare baked goods for customers in a remote place, like resorts, wedding celebrations, occasions and even workplaces. A bakeshop selling items at a counter without an eating area. Functions one sort of baked items, such as wedding event cakes, cupcakes or gluten-free breads. A combination of bakeshop and caf that markets baked items and provides a dining area for customers.
The sort of bakery you wish to operate establishes various other facets of business, such as the amount of space, tools and active ingredients you need, as well as start-up costs. We'll discuss those details next. Once you have some idea of the sort of bakeshop you wish to open, the next action is to develop a pastry shop business strategy.
